Familiar Touch: A Film Screening and Conversation
Join us for a screening of Familiar Touch, a poignant debut feature by Sarah Friedland that explores aging, caregiving, and dementia with honesty and warmth. The story follows Ruth, an octogenarian adjusting to life in assisted living, portrayed by Kathleen Chalfant in an award-winning performance. Both tender and unexpectedly joyful, the film redefines what it means to grow older.
Filmed at Villa Gardens, a Front Porch community, the production engaged residents and staff as collaborators—on screen and behind the scenes—blurring the line between fiction and real life. Stay for a post-film discussion with the filmmakers and cast. Learn more at
